When you call for a sliding door repair, the final bill depends on what is actually happening inside the track. Costs shift based on whether we just need to clean out years of debris, swap out worn-out rollers, or replace a track that has been bent or damaged. If the glass itself is cracked or the locking mechanism needs a complete overhaul, that adds to the labor and parts required. We look at the specific size and weight of your door to ensure the hardware fits correctly.

A sliding door that won't slide smoothly usually requires attention to its rollers and track. Professionals in Detroit will inspect these parts, clear any obstructions, and replace any worn components. This is a common issue in older homes throughout the city. Getting a glass sliding door back on track typically involves lifting the door carefully and guiding it into the frame. If the track itself is bent or damaged, professional help is needed.
